Businesses and Organisations

Although the profile of Linux and open source software in Zambia is small, there is (just as in businesses across the world) a lot of OSS being used - for example, email and web servers as well as open programming languages like PHP, Perl and Python. In particular, NGOs and educational institutions tend to find that the cost benefits and the growth of local expertise that happens when you use open source solutions match their missions neatly.
